Code Analysis: Advanced Shipping Rates for WooCommerce 2.1.0

Most Complex Classes

Class Rating Complexity
Fish_n_Ships
D
531
Fish_n_Ships_Wizard
D
251
WC_Fish_n_Ships
D
177
Fish_n_Ships_group
A
60
Fish_n_Ships_SB
S
44
Fish_n_Ships_Boxes
S
3
Fish_n_Ships_Shipping
S
2
Fish_n_Ships_Date
S
2

Most Complex Functions

Function Rating Complexity
WC_Fish_n_Ships::calculate_shipping()
D
86
wc_fns_check_matching_selection_method_fn()
D
69
wc_fns_sanitize_selection_fields_fn()
D
57
Fish_n_Ships_Wizard::create_sample_settings()
D
51
wc_fns_calculate_cost_rule_fn()
D
45
Fish_n_Ships::sanitize_shipping_rules()
D
38
WC_Fish_n_Ships::evaluate_simple_condition_block()
D
35
wc_fns_sanitize_cost_fn()
D
33
Fish_n_Ships_Wizard::get_html_case()
C
29
Fish_n_Ships_SB::admin_fields()
C
24
wc_fns_get_html_price_fields_fn()
B
19
Fish_n_Ships_group::calculate()
B
19